In a realm shrouded in darkness, the Nazgûl emerged as ominous specters, ensnared by Sauron's One Ring during the Second and Third Ages. These nine dread servants became the embodiment of his malevolence.
Long ago, Celebrimbor forged nineteen Rings of Power, but Sauron seized sixteen. Nine of these Rings fell into the hands of powerful Men, who would later become the Ringwraiths.
Empowered by their Rings, the Ringwraiths amassed wealth, power, and prestige. However, their ascent came at a terrible cost – they became slaves to Sauron's will, forever tied to the One Ring.
The downfall of Sauron in the Second Age briefly scattered the Ringwraiths, but their dark existence persisted as long as the Ring endured.
In the Third Age, led by the Witch-king of Angmar, they launched a relentless assault on Arnor.
Arthedain valiantly defended the Weather Hills, but the Witch-king's capture of Fornost led to Arthedain's fall.
Eärnur of Gondor arrived too late to save Arthedain but triumphed in the Battle of Fornost, driving the Witch-king into retreat.
The Witch-king fled, leaving Arnor's once-prosperous lands desolate.
The Ringwraiths returned to Mordor, where Sauron rebuilt his forces in preparation for his return.
Relentlessly, the Nazgûl scoured the Shire, sowing fear among the unsuspecting hobbits.
Gollum's capture exposed the Shire's location, setting the Ringwraiths on their perilous path.
Crossing into Rohan, they drew ever nearer to their elusive prey in the Shire.
Reaching the west shore of Anduin, they received horses and clothes, renewing their hunt.
Meeting Nazgûl from Dol Guldur, they learned that no hobbits had inhabited the Vales of Anduin for years.
The Nazgûl continued their northern march, spreading terror throughout Rohan.
Arriving at Isengard, Saruman, tempted by the Ring's power, initially denied them aid.
Pursuing Gandalf through Rohan, they interrogated Gríma Wormtongue, extracting information about the Shire.
Gríma revealed the Shire's location and was released by Saruman, fearing both the Nazgûl and Gandalf.
The Ringwraiths divided into pairs, riding swiftly toward the Shire, intensifying their pursuit.
Capturing a spy with maps and notes, they drew closer to their elusive prey.
Crossing the Greyflood at Tharbad, they closed in on the Shire.
A brutal assault on the Rangers guarding Sarn Ford left few survivors.
The Witch-king sent four riders into the Shire, while he established a camp at Andrath, poised to strike.
The Nazgûl patrolled the Shire's borders, casting a chilling shadow over its inhabitants.
Discovering Crickhollow deserted, they assaulted Bree in their relentless pursuit of the Ring.
Gandalf, Aragorn, and the Hobbits forged an alliance to escape the relentless Nazgûl.
Finding Crickhollow empty, the Ringwraiths realized their prey had eluded them for now.
Gandalf, Aragorn, and the Hobbits united their wits to outsmart the relentless Ringwraiths.
At Weathertop, the Witch-king stabbed Frodo with a Morgul-knife, but Aragorn's arrival with firebrands drove them away, if only temporarily.

In an age shrouded in darkness, Gwaihir, the Windlord, reigned as a lord among the Great Eagles. His lineage traced back to the mighty Thorondor, and his destiny intertwined with that of Gandalf the Grey.
In the year 3018 of the Third Age, Gandalf tasked Gwaihir and his kin with a crucial mission—to gather intelligence about the Enemy's plans. Their noble wings carried them far and wide, uncovering tidings of the Nazgûl, amassing Orc armies, and Gollum's escape.
It was during this mission that Gwaihir found Gandalf imprisoned atop Orthanc. Without hesitation, he rescued the wizard, forming a deep bond. They reunited later when Gandalf defeated a Balrog but was trapped on a mountaintop. Gwaihir's wings bore Gandalf to safety.
Their paths crossed again in 3019, when Gwaihir sought news of the Fellowship. In the final days of the War of the Ring, Gwaihir led the Eagles to the Black Gate. They confronted the Nazgûl, allowing Frodo and Sam to reach Mount Doom. Gwaihir's keen eyes spotted them amidst the chaos, and the Eagles saved them from the fiery abyss.
Gwaihir became a symbol of hope and courage, a beacon of light in the darkest hour. His name echoed through Middle-earth, a testament to the nobility of the Eagles of Valinor.
